| 1:31.0 | So we are in the most famous of Isaiah chapters, I think, at least for people like us, right? I mean, this is a big one. This is a |
| 1:38.9 | chapter that we hear every year. If you go to like a Good Friday service, you likely hear this text read. |
| 1:49.5 | This is like your Old Testament Good Friday go-to. |
| 1:55.3 | And for your very good reason. |
| 1:58.0 | This is one of those, if it ain't broke, don't fix it kind of thing. |
| 2:00.6 | It's because I don't think you're going to do any better on Good Friday than |
| 2:03.5 | than Isaiah 53. Uh, the chapter before this, we heard about, uh, God's coming salvation. |
| 2:13.1 | And in Isaiah 53, we get to hear exactly what that salvation looks like. and man, does it not look like what you would think it looks like? |
| 2:20.9 | I mean, and God says he's coming to save you. This is not what you expect. |
| 2:26.3 | Yeah, Isaiah's been getting us ready for Chapter 53 for quite a while. |
| 2:31.4 | He's talked about the rebellions of Israel. He's talked about exile and return. |
| 2:36.5 | He talks about this salvation, which he's going to accomplish by means of his servant, which isn't just for Israel, but for all the nations. |
| 2:44.2 | But he hasn't really told us, how's this going to happen? And he's pinpointed this figure, this servant, who's going to be also a ruler |
